“The Monkees were like a 1960's Backstreet Boys but different because the corporate machine had never really been set in motion on a scale like that before. The Monkees were smart, though, and realized they were super cheezy. From then on they demanded to write and perform on their own stuff and gave up (some of their) fame and fortune to make their own music. I really respect that and think some of their best stuff came from when they were trying to find themselves.
